Date | Name | Activity | Value |
|---|---|---|---|
Aug 21, 2025 | xxxxxxxxxxxxx | $191213690 | |
Aug 21, 2025 | xxxxxxxxxxxxx | $191213690 | |
Mar 17, 2025 | xxxxxxxxxxxxx | $282 |
Date | Firm | Activity | Value |
|---|---|---|---|
Jun 30, 2025 | xxxxxxxxxxxxx | $333252 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$11309368 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$11717849 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$32568164 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 7,360,684 | Institution | 10.83% | 405,352,868 | |
| 6,722,227 | Institution | 9.89% | 370,193,041 | |
| 6,161,211 | Institution | 9.06% | 339,297,890 | |
| 5,687,373 | Institution | 8.36% | 313,203,631 | |
| 4,818,251 | Institution | 7.09% | 265,341,083 | |
| 3,477,227 | Insider | 5.11% | 191,490,891 | |
| 3,477,227 | Insider | 5.11% | 191,490,891 | |
| 1,862,915 | Institution | 2.74% | 102,590,729 | |
| 1,397,934 | Institution | 2.06% | 76,984,225 | |
| 1,320,252 | Institution | 1.94% | 72,706,278 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 5,687,373 | Institution | 8.36% | 313,203,631 | |
| 4,818,251 | Institution | 7.09% | 265,341,083 | |
| 1,862,915 | Institution | 2.74% | 102,590,729 | |
| 1,397,934 | Institution | 2.06% | 76,984,225 | |
| 997,196 | Institution | 1.47% | 54,915,584 | |
| 891,671 | Institution | 1.31% | 49,104,322 | |
| 889,202 | Institution | 1.31% | 48,968,354 | |
| 729,655 | Institution | 1.07% | 40,182,101 | |
| 586,461 | Institution | 0.86% | 32,296,407 | |
| 576,412 | Institution | 0.85% | 31,743,009 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 2,169,222 | Institution | 3.19% | 119,459,056 | |
| 2,138,148 | Institution | 3.14% | 172,056,770 | |
| 2,075,450 | Institution | 3.05% | 113,942,205 | |
| 1,624,939 | Institution | 2.39% | 89,485,391 | |
| 1,597,570 | Institution | 2.35% | 87,706,593 | |
| 891,765 | Institution | 1.31% | 48,957,899 | |
| 742,282 | Institution | 1.09% | 40,751,282 | |
| 595,479 | Institution | 0.88% | 32,793,029 | |
| 509,367 | Institution | 0.75% | 28,050,841 | |
| 444,410 | Institution | 0.65% | 24,473,659 |